Zinc nitrate hexahydrate
Description
Zinc nitrate hexahydrate (CAS 10196-18-6) is a water-soluble zinc salt supplying both zinc and nitrate ions in a single, readily dissolved form. It functions as a corrosion inhibitor, coagulant, and source of reactive zinc across a range of industrial processes.
In agriculture, it is used as a foliar micronutrient source and in fertilizer blends where fast zinc availability is required for crop uptake. Water treatment operations apply it as a coagulation aid and corrosion inhibitor in distribution systems.
In cooling water circuits, it provides essential protection against oxidative damage. In mining and metals processing, it supports surface treatment and galvanizing operations where controlled zinc deposition is needed for high-quality finishes.
Construction chemistry formulators incorporate it into concrete admixtures and cementitious coatings to inhibit corrosion of embedded steel reinforcement. This ensures the long-term structural integrity of various infrastructure projects.
Zinc nitrate hexahydrate is supplied as white crystalline granules or prills, with liquid solution grades also available for direct dosing applications. These formats allow for flexible integration into existing manufacturing workflows.
Standard supply grades include technical and agricultural quality, with specifications typically aligned to purity thresholds of 98% or higher. This ensures consistent performance across demanding industrial and chemical synthesis applications.
